Sunny has led programs, action centers and global networks focused on social innovation and knowledge creation that have reached over 150 countries. He has worked both internationally, nationally and in California on scalable treatment algorithms for cardiometabolic conditions.
Sunny led policy engineering and design to modernize the World Health Organization Essential Medicines List, a listing of the 400-plus most important medicines globally.
Sunny has worked with the steering committee of the National Academy of Medicine Action Collaborative on Clinician Well-Being & Resilience to pioneer new models, approaches, perspectives, and collective action with health leadership.
